Output 80603b21c00a3fc69f010bde97ab7363862c5f48b4d07a94c6087f006a25dbbd:0

value
28778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bd964718c13f64b0987f4f95a84085febdb6b9 OP_EQUAL
address
3Qe6eRvEocRQfDxwtAV7aGCzG9GK2tPL1E
transaction
80603b21c00a3fc69f010bde97ab7363862c5f48b4d07a94c6087f006a25dbbd
spent
true